Description

This collection consists of one notebook by Robert H. Gibbs containing data on a collection of dragonflies made in the United States, Canada, and Mexico, but principally in the eastern United States. Some collecting was done in the south, southwest, and west. A complete record of habitat from which most specimens were taken and occasional notes of the chase for especially prized specimens are included in the notebook.
